Window Blinds and Curtains: Top Decorating Tips
In terms of decor trends, curtains have gone in two opposite directions: they became either more “feminine” made of embroidered and patterned fabrics with rich draping; or minimal as Calvin Klein suit, made of natural fabrics in neutral tones. To add a personal touch, you may choose to place curtains on elaborate cast metal rings or find an antique details in flee markets.

Mini Laptops
Mini laptops are mostly used by businesspersons and traveling employees. The price of mini laptops that offer basic features may range from $500 to $2000. Advanced mini laptops may be slightly more expensive and offer features similar to an average laptop without compromising on size. Mini laptops can be purchased from computer vending stores all over the nation or online on trade websites such as e-Bay and Amazon.

Buying a Laptop Computer
As for RAM, 512MB is a must, considering the sophisticated applications that are available today. A laptop with upgradeable RAM would be good if you anticipate running short of RAM in the future. Buy the maximum RAM capacity that you can afford, as the amount of memory that a laptop can handle is limited.

Tips for Buying Your Digital Camera
Know your battery: As any portable electronic device digital cameras are powered by batteries. There are different battery technologies each with its cons and pros. Knowing your options can help you get a camera that better suits your needs. The first choice is disposable or rechargeable. Some cameras support both usually when using standard size batteries like AA, AAA.

What Is A Megapixel And Isn't More Always Better?
The megapixel count is also used to decide the size of a print. A 3MP camera can provide excellent 4x6 inch prints, while a 4 or 5MP digital camera can deliver high quality 8x10 inch prints. This is because the resolution of a print is directly proportional to the number of pixels. Another interesting metric is the pixel ratio.

How To Choose The Right Digital Camera To Preserve Those Special Moments
The next factor is the optical zoom feature. This is different from digital zoom! Digital zoom only makes objects appear closer by slicing off the edges around the photo and expanding the image. This technique can actually cause lower resolution. Pay attention to the optical zoom feature of the camera, and make sure it works well for you.

About Vitamin A
Vitamin A is a fat soluble vitamin found naturally in such foods as orange and yellow fruits, vegetables such as spinach, and animal fats. Fat soluble vitamins can generally be stored in the body. In vegetables, vitamin A is found in the form of beta-carotene which is water soluble. Among other things, this means that excess of this form of vitamin A can be eliminated from the body through natural processes.
